The wiring diagram for a 3-wire system typically includes a hot wire (black), a neutral wire (white), and a ground wire (green or bare copper). The hot wire carries the electrical current, the neutral wire completes the circuit, and the ground wire provides safety by grounding excess electricity. It is important to follow the specific wiring instructions for your particular system to ensure proper installation and safety.

Wasp can cause damage to electrical wiring. This occurs when wasps invade an electrical component such as air conditioning unit outside and build their nest inside of the unit. The most common occurrence is the nest causing an electrical short.

To install a Google Nest thermostat, first turn off the power to your heating and cooling system. Remove your old thermostat and label the wires. Connect the wires to the corresponding terminals on the Nest base. Attach the Nest display to the base and turn the power back on. Follow the on-screen instructions to complete the setup on the Nest app.

If your wiper fuse keeps blowing, there is either a short or a "dry connection" in your wiring, or the earth/ground wire isn't making a good contact, try getting a wiring schematics/ diagram and check your wires for any sign of shorting out or corrosion damage. Never put in a larger fuse as this will cause your wires to burn and can cause insulation on your wires to melt and possibly cause a fire!
